Key Insights of Japan RFID Handheld Reader Market

  • Market Size (2023): Estimated at approximately $500 million, reflecting steady adoption across key sectors.
  • Forecast Value (2026): Projected to reach $750 million, driven by technological upgrades and expanding use cases.
  • CAGR (2026–2033): Expected at 6.5%, indicating sustained growth amid digital transformation initiatives.
  • Leading Segment: Handheld RFID readers with integrated barcode scanning capabilities dominate, accounting for over 60% of sales.
  • Core Application: Inventory management and asset tracking remain primary drivers, especially in logistics and retail.
  • Leading Geography: Greater Tokyo and Kansai regions hold over 55% market share due to dense industrial activity.
  • Key Market Opportunity: Integration of AI and IoT features in handheld devices offers significant differentiation potential.
  • Major Companies: Zebra Technologies, Honeywell, Denso Wave, and NEC are leading providers with extensive local partnerships.

Dynamic Market Analysis: Porter’s Five Forces in Japan RFID Handheld Reader Market

  • Supplier Power: Moderate, with a limited number of specialized component providers, but high switching costs for device manufacturers.
  • Buyer Power: High, as enterprise clients demand customized solutions and competitive pricing, influencing product development.
  • Competitive Rivalry: Intense, driven by innovation cycles and strategic alliances among global and local players.
  • Threat of New Entrants: Moderate, due to high R&D costs and established brand loyalty but mitigated by technological complexity.
  • Threat of Substitutes: Low, as RFID remains the most efficient technology for real-time asset tracking, with alternatives like barcode scanning less capable in dynamic environments.
